1-800-Flowers.com played up Pantone’s 2018 Color of the Year, Ultra Violet, on Valentine’s Day with a Passion for Purple collection, which is also being promoted for spring holidays.

On Valentine’s Day, 1-800-Flowers.com focused energy on connecting with mobile shoppers and streamlining interactions with popular voice-enabled technology and Flower Shop Network members saw “significant increases in orders placed.”

Those are two additional takeaways from our ongoing coverage of the holiday, from the perspective of national brands.

Other highlights include:

1-800-Flowers.com. This year, mobile shoppers could order from 1-800-Flowers.com via chat and voice “across a variety of platforms,” said Liz Castoro, director, enterprise public relations. “Customers were able to easily order popular floral arrangements on Google Assistant-enabled Android devices and iPhones for delivery nationwide. Customers used Google Assistant to shop selections from the brand’s ‘Fresh from the Farm’ collection on Google Express.” The company also enhanced its voice-enabled technology through Amazon Alexa, to “streamline dialog.” The company was not able to provide sales or trend numbers.

Flower Shop Network. “According to analytics February 1st thru February 14th our members saw significant increases in orders placed, increases varied by shop with some as high as 38 percent,” said Loranne Atwill, co-owner and CFO. “On average, conversion rates increased 15 percent over last year. Many of our shops also reported an increase in average order value.”
